Kinetic Concepts Inc et al v. Bluesky Medical Corp, No. 2:07-cv-00188 (E.D. Tex. Jan. 15, 2008)

Before the court is the defendants’ motion (#29) to transfer venue to the Western District of Texas–San Antonio Division. 1 In this case, the plaintiffs (c ollectively referred to as “Kinetic Concepts”) have accused the defendants of infringing U.S. Patent No. 7,216,651, which is directed to wound care therapies. For the reasons discussed below, the court grants the defendants’ motion (#29) to transfer, and orders the clerk to transfer this case to the Western District of Texas–San Antonio Division. 1.
